Deciding on the Ideal Care: Government vs. Independent Mental Health
Navigating the landscape of mental care can feel overwhelming , especially when considering your alternatives. psychiatric hospital Many individuals face the choice of whether to utilize state -funded services or choose private mental wellness therapists. Public resources often offer subsidized treatment , though wait times can be significant and availability may be restricted . Alternatively, private providers typically provide faster sessions and a greater selection of approaches, but at a higher fee. Ultimately, the ideal path depends on individual circumstances , financial resources , and individual desires.
- Assess your budget circumstances .
- Explore delays for public services .
- Consider your desired level of confidentiality .
Past the Boundaries
Supporting people with mental health conditions extends far beyond the limits of institutions . A comprehensive approach necessitates social participation , offering accessible resources like supported living , employment opportunities, and psychological counseling . Bridging the gap between clinical settings and independent living is essential for sustained recovery and preventing relapse . This demands a joint undertaking between healthcare providers , families , and the general public .
